Hants North Community Food Bank is a charitable organization based in Latties Brook, Nova Scotia, classified by the CRA under organizations relieving poverty. In its fiscal year ending March 31, 2024, it reported $247K in revenue and $240K in expenditures.

Its funding that year was roughly 15% from donations, 81% from other charities. In 2024, 3 other registered charities reported granting it a combined $4,555.

Compared with 2,470 poverty-relief charities of similar size, its share of spending on mission — charitable programs plus grants to other charities — ranked above 69% of peers.

In its own words

Providing food to needy families/individuals. We are open weekly for clients to access food and/or contact information to access other community resources. We are entirely staffed by volunteers from surrounding communities.
